#902700 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#902700 is composed of 56.5% red, 15.3%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 72.9% magenta, 100% yellow and 43.5% black. It has a hue angle of 16.3 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 28.2%. #902700 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ff4e00 with #210000. Closest websafe color is: #993300.

● #902700 color description : Dark orange [Brown tone].
#902700 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#902700 has RGB values of R:144, G:39,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.73, Y:1, K:0.44. Its decimal value is 9447168.

Shades and Tints of #902700
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070200 is the darkest color, while #fff6f2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#902700
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4e4542 is the less saturated color, while #902700 is the most saturated one.
